How long does it take to develop a website in the UK?
Simple websites can be launched in 1–2 weeks, while complex e-commerce or corporate websites may take 6–12 weeks depending on design, functionality, and content readiness. The development process includes planning, design, backend development, testing, and deployment. Proper project management ensures timely delivery without compromising quality.
What is the cost of website development in the UK?
Costs vary based on complexity: simple websites may start at £1,500–4,000, while custom e-commerce or corporate portals can range from £10,000–80,000+. Costs include design, development, hosting, CMS integration, SEO, and ongoing maintenance. Investing appropriately ensures a professional, functional, and future-proof website.
What is the difference between custom-built websites and template-based websites?
Template-based websites use pre-designed layouts for faster deployment and lower costs but have limited customization. Custom-built websites are designed from scratch to meet specific business goals, offering complete branding, functionality, and scalability. Many UK businesses prefer custom solutions to differentiate themselves and provide a premium user experience.
How can I optimize my website for speed in the UK?
Website speed can be improved by compressing images, leveraging caching, minimizing code, and using Content Delivery Networks (CDN). Fast-loading websites enhance user experience, SEO rankings, and reduce bounce rates. Speed optimization is particularly important for e-commerce sites and high-traffic corporate websites.

What security measures should UK websites have?
SSL certificates, secure hosting, firewalls, backups, and anti-malware protection are essential. E-commerce websites must comply with PCI-DSS standards to ensure secure online payments. Strong security protects user data, maintains trust, and ensures compliance with UK regulations.

How do I choose a hosting provider in the UK?
Reliable hosting providers offer fast servers, 24/7 support, scalability, and high uptime guarantees. Local UK hosting ensures faster load times and improved SEO, while international cloud solutions like AWS, Google Cloud, and Azure are ideal for enterprise websites. Hosting should also include security, backups, and performance optimization.
